Breakfast nook sets come in several different designs. The traditional design uses high-backed, L-shaped benches positioned together at an angle, a trestle table and a third bench for additional seating on the other side of the table. What a perfect setting for informal family meals or game nights! Think, too, about sunny mornings spent sitting at your nook with a cup of tea while enjoying the garden view outside your window. This design comes with a bonus: storage space inside the benches. Lift up the seats and you will find deep wells suitable for storing dishes and linens and pots and pans when not in use.
Other breakfast nooks incorporate a pub look with high round tables and stools or two opposite-facing benches with a table in between. It all depends on your taste and the size of your nook. Even if you do not have a separate nook space in your kitchen, you can create a sense of separateness by laying down contrasting tiles or a rug in that area. Cushions and other accessories in the same contrasting color scheme complete the scene.
Breakfast nooks also come in a variety of wood types and finishes to suit just about any taste. Or, if you prefer, you can purchase an unfinished nook and complete the set with your own personal touch.
